sql >> Database teknologi >  >> RDS >> PostgreSQL

currval Funktion i PostgreSQL, der klager over, at kolonnen ikke eksisterer

Det viser sig, at dette var et problem med store bogstaver og kurser. Fordi jeg ville bevare store bogstaver i relationsnavnet, skulle jeg bruge begge enkelt og dobbelte anførselstegn for at overføre det korrekte relationsnavn til currval .

Jeg ændrede forespørgslen til SELECT currval('"Concept_cid_seq"'); (bemærk de yderste anførselstegn), og det fungerede korrekt.




  1. Opdel mysql-forespørgsler i array, hver forespørgsel adskilt af;

  2. Bedste måde at tælle rækker fra mysql database

  3. Sådan stopper du denne gentagelse og grupperer efter dato

  4. NodeJS MySQL:mål forespørgsels eksekveringstid